How they compare
SDG: Europe currently reports 3.3% against 2.7% in Panama, a difference of 0.6%.
That makes SDG: Europe's figure about 1.2 times Panama's.
The two have swapped places 1 time across 21 shared years of data; in 1998 it was Panama ahead.
Panama ranks 132nd and SDG: Europe ranks 130th of 175 countries.
Across the 4 decades both report, Panama averaged higher in 2 and SDG: Europe in 2.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Panama | SDG: Europe |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1990s | 2.7% | 2.2% | 0.5% | Panama |
| 2000s | 2.5% | 2.0% | 0.5% | Panama |
| 2010s | 2.5% | 2.8% | 0.3% | SDG: Europe |
| 2020s | 2.7% | 3.4% | 0.7% | SDG: Europe |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
